Courtyard Charleston Historic District in Charleston completes a multi-million dollar renovation project

The hotel’s recent revitalization presents a complete transformation of all of the hotel’s guestrooms.

CHARLESTON, SC – The Courtyard by Marriott Charleston Historic District hotel located at 125 Calhoun Street is pleased to unveil its new look after a multi-million dollar transformation that includes extensive renovations to the guest rooms, guest bathrooms, public spaces and meeting rooms plus an upgraded Bistro. The 176-room hotel operates as a Marriott franchise, owned by RLJ Lodging Trust of Bethesda, Maryland and managed by Interstate Hotels & Resorts of Arlington, Virginia.

This six-story property is ideally situated downtown, adjacent to Marion Square, the host of many world-renowned festivals. The newly revitalized hotel is located on the footprint of the College of Charleston, and within walking distance to the historic Charleston City Market, the South Carolina Aquarium, the Medical University of South Carolina, and historic Charleston’s best attractions, restaurants and nightlife.

“Our hotel has always been a favorite of both business and leisure travelers,” said Jim Fournier, general manager, Courtyard Charleston Historic District. “With these enhancements, we now offer an even greater value and experience for all of our guests.”

The lobby level has been completely redesigned with new carpeting, hard-surface flooring, light fixtures, wallpaper and artwork. The upgraded Bistro serves Starbucksa products as well as seasonal breakfast fare in the morning, and a full-service bar and small plates in the evening. Suitable for hosting events for up to 175 people, the Courtyard Charleston Historic District has also updated its 7,800 square feet of flexible meeting space.

The hotel’s recent revitalization presents a complete transformation of all of the hotel’s guestrooms. All rooms now feature modern hard-surface flooring, mini-refrigerators, new mattresses for optimal sleep, plus 42-inch HDTV’s. Rejuvenated guest bathrooms include modernized LED mirrored vanities and king-rooms feature renovated walk-in showers.

Other onsite amenities at the Courtyard Charleston Historic District include a full-time Concierge, a 24-hour fitness center, a heated outdoor swimming pool, guest laundry, business center and The Market, a 24/7 shop for snacks and beverages. The hotel currently offers valet parking and boasts renovated outdoor space with a communal fire pit and heat lamps.
